Sections 9, 9A and 9B of the Court Security Act 2005 (NSW)
9 Use of recording devices in court premises
(1) A person must not use a recording device to record sound or images (or both) in court premises.
Maximum penalty - 200 penalty units or imprisonment for 12 months (or both).
Note -
This subsection only prohibits the use of a recording device to record sound or images (or both) and not any other use of the device. For example, this subsection would not prohibit a person from using a mobile phone with recording capabilities to make a telephone call, but would prohibit the use of the phone to record court proceedings.
(2) Subsection (1) does not apply with respect to any of the following -
(a) the use of a recording device that has been expressly permitted by a judicial officer,
(b) the use by a lawyer of a recording device to record the lawyer's own voice in a part of court premises other than a room where a court is sitting,
(c) the use of a recording device by a person for the purpose of transcribing court proceedings for the court,
(d) the use of a recording device by a journalist while exercising a right referred to in section 6 (2),
(e) the use of such recording devices in such other kinds of circumstances as may be prescribed by the regulations.
9A Prohibition on unauthorised transmission of court proceedings from courtroom
(1) A person must not use any device to transmit sounds or images (or both) from a room or other place where a court is sitting, or to transmit information that forms part of the proceedings of a court from a room or other place where that court is sitting, in any of the following ways -
(a) by transmitting the sounds, images or information to any person or place outside that room or other place,
(b) by posting entries containing the sounds, images or information on social media sites or any other website,
(c) by otherwise broadcasting or publishing the sounds, images or information by means of the Internet,
(d) by otherwise making the sounds, images or information accessible to any person outside that room or other place,
whether that transmission, posting, broadcasting, publishing or other conduct occurs simultaneously with the proceedings or at a later time (or both).
Maximum penalty - 200 penalty units or imprisonment for 12 months (or both).
(2) Subsection (1) does not apply to any of the following -
(a) a device being used for a purpose other than a purpose referred to in subsection (1),
(b) the transmission of sounds, images or information by an audio link, audio visual link, closed-circuit link or other technology that enables communication between the room or other place where the court is sitting and another place and that has been expressly permitted by a judicial officer,
(c) any other transmission of sounds, images or information that has been expressly approved by a judicial officer,
(d) the transmission of sounds, images or information for the purpose of transcribing court proceedings for the court at a place outside the room or other place where the court is sitting,
(e) the use by a prosecutor of a tablet computer or other similar device to transmit sounds, images or information only to another prosecutor who either is not a witness in the relevant court proceedings or, if he or she is such a witness, who has already given evidence in those proceedings,
(f) the transmission of sounds, images or information in any circumstances that may be prescribed by the regulations.
9B Prohibition on unauthorised distribution of court recording
(1) A person must not transmit or distribute a recording of sounds or images (or both) of court proceedings, including part of a recording, by any means.
Maximum penalty - 200 penalty units or imprisonment for 12 months, or both.
(2) Subsection (1) does not apply unless the person knows or suspects, or ought reasonably to know or suspect, that none of the following apply -
(a) the transmission or distribution of the recording has been expressly approved by a judicial officer,
(b) the transmission or distribution of the recording is for the purpose of transcribing court proceedings for the court,
(c) the transmission or distribution of the recording occurred in any other circumstances prescribed by the regulations.
